The data indicates that the most common recent mileage reading for the Toyota Yaris (2005-11) 3DR HATCHBACK is between 70,000 and 80,000 miles, accounting for 16.9% of recordings. Many vehicles also fall within the 60,000 to 70,000 mile range (11.6%) and the 90,000 to 100,000 mile range (14%). Notably, a relatively small percentage of vehicles have very low mileage, with only 1.2% recorded at 0 to 10,000 miles. Additionally, there are some vehicles with very high mileage, particularly in the 160,000+ mile range, though these are quite rare (around 2%). Overall, the data suggests that typical mileage tends to cluster around the 60,000 to 100,000 mile range, with fewer vehicles at the extremes.

The data indicates that the majority of private sale valuations for the Toyota Yaris (2005-11) 3-door hatchback, 1.3 VVTI 87 T3 MMT Auto, fall within the £2000 to £3000 range, accounting for approximately 75.6% of the sample. A smaller portion, around 20.3%, are valued between £1000 and £2000, while only 4.1% are estimated to be between £3000 and £4000. This suggests that most vehicles of this model and age are typically valued in the lower to mid-thousands of pounds, with very few reaching higher private sale prices.

The data indicates that the majority of these Toyota Yaris models (2005-2011) were manufactured in 2006, accounting for approximately 74.4% of the sample. A smaller proportion was produced in 2007 (16.9%). Very few vehicles in the sample were manufactured in 2008 (8.1%) or 2009 (0.6%). This suggests that the 2006 model is the most prevalent among these vehicles, possibly reflecting a high turnover during that production year or a preference among used car buyers for vehicles from that year.

The data indicates that the most common main paint colour for the Toyota Yaris (2005-11) 3-door hatchback with the specified engine and transmission is silver, accounting for approximately 59.3% of the vehicles. Blue is the second most popular colour at 27.3%, followed by black at 8.7%, red at 4.1%, and green at just 0.6%. This suggests a strong preference for silver and blue among owners of this vehicle model, with other colours being relatively uncommon.

The data shows a diverse distribution of registered keepers for the Toyota Yaris (2005-11) 3DR Hatchback 1.3 VVTI 87 T3 MMT Auto5. Notably, the largest proportion of vehicles (20.9%) have had four registered keepers, indicating a significant share with moderate ownership changes. Additionally, a sizable percentage (15.1%) have had five keepers, and a combined 34.2% of vehicles have between four and six keepers (4, 5, and 6). The vehicles with fewer keepers—such as one (1.2%) and two (5.8%)—are less common, suggesting that most vehicles have experienced multiple ownerships. Interestingly, a small fraction (around 0.6%) with 18 keepers reflects some vehicles with extensive ownership history. Overall, the data indicates a typical pattern of moderate turnover in ownership, with most vehicles changing hands between four and six times.
